You don't want to lose your saved games....I had a memory card go on me one time my son cired for hours and I wanted to also
When the 360 dies your hard drive is fine. you only send the console to get fixed. the hard drive keeps all your info. when you get the new box you just attach the hard drive and your right were you left off
Thank you, I had asked that a while back and everyone told me you did not get the hard drive back....well then that take a reason off of my list for not getting a 360
the customer service person tells you. only send the console, if you send any cables or the hard drive you will not get them back. if people are stupid and send the whole thing anyways, thats their fault for not following directions.
So you can take out the hard drive in a 360?
yes it's detachable. press a little button and it pops off.
